Georges v Ozz Projects (Aust) Pty Ltd [2021] NSWCATCD 104

Georges v Ozz Projects (Aust) Pty Ltd [2021] NSWCATCD 104

Applicant was partly successful on contractual issues and delay, but not on the quantum claimed. Costs should be apportioned to reflect partial success, respondent's responsibility for delays, and principles of fairness in proceedings exceeding $30,000. Therefore, respondent is ordered to pay 60% of applicant's costs.

Court Disposition

Costs partially awarded to applicant; respondent's costs application dismissed.

Orders

  • ['Pursuant to s 50(2) of the Civil and Administrative Tribunal Act 2013 NSW, determination on the papers without hearing.' "Respondent Ozz Projects (AUST) Pty Ltd to pay 60% of applicant's costs, as agreed or assessed." "Respondent's application for costs dismissed."]
